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Polignano a Mare to Valletta is to bus and shuttle and bus and ferry which costs €120 - €150 and takes 20h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Polignano a Mare to Valletta is to taxi and fly which takes 2h 37m and costs €95 - €240.
No, there is no direct bus from Polignano a Mare to Valletta. However, there are services departing from Polignano a Mare and arriving at Valletta via Bari, Catania Airport and Pozzallo.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 17h 30m.
The distance between Polignano a Mare and Valletta is 670 km.
The best way to get from Polignano a Mare to Valletta without a car is to train and bus and ferry which takes 17h 17m and costs €310 - €450.
It takes approximately 2h 37m to get from Polignano a Mare to Valletta, including transfers.
Polignano a Mare to Valletta b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Bari station.
Polignano a Mare to Valletta b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Catania Airport station.
There are 6248+ hotels available in Valletta.
What companies run services between Polignano a Mare, Italy and Valletta, Malta?
There is no direct connection from Polignano a Mare to Valletta. However, you can take the taxi to Bari-Airport-BRI airport, fly to Malta International Airport (MLA), walk to Malta Airport 2, then take the line 117 bus to Ingieret, San Vincenz/Luqa. Alternatively, you can take a train from Polignano A Mare to Valletta via Bari Centrale, Lamezia Terme C., Siracusa, Ispica, and Pozzallo in around 17h 17m.
